4.5.3 FULL SCALE CALIBRATION PROCEDURES
NOTE:

Before attempting to calibrate the 760-A Aquaswitch analog meter,

refer to Section 4.5.1.
STEP 1 Turn OFF main AC power.
STEP 2 Being careful no! to excessively strain the cables, unfasten

and remove the front panel.

STEP 3 Remove all five (5) wires from the 760-A Control board

terminal TB3. (See Fig. 4-1) .

STEP 4 By following the wiring diagram in Fig. 4-5, connect the

Calibrator Module’s lead wires to the 760-A Control board

TB3 terminal block connectors.

STEP 5 Turn ON the main AC power and verify that the 760-

A Aquaswitch analog meter is indicating a full scale

reading.

NOTE:

If the meter indicates an accurate reading, proceed to STEP 7. If

the meter does not indicate the appropriate reading, proceed to

STEP 6.
STEP 6 Turn the 760-A Control board’s Calibration trimmer (R8)

adjustment screw (see Fig. 4-1) until the meter displays

a full scale reading.

STEP 7 Remove the Calibrator Module’s lead wires and reconnect

the CS10 Cell cable wires as shown in Fig. 2-6.

4.6 PREVENTIVE CARE
The Myron L Company- recommends that the following Preventive

Care procedures be observed.

1 Try to prevent exposure to excessive heat and moisture.
2 The Aquaswitch main AC power source must be protected

against excessive voltage “spikes.”

3 Take care not to damage the Aquaswitch during handling.

NOTE:

Daily, weekly or monthly maintenance schedules are based upon

the frequency of use and the severity of the environment and

operating conditions.
STEP 1 Repeat the Aquaswitch Checkout procedures to

verify satisfactory operation and/or isolate possible

troubleshooting symptoms.

STEP 2 Check all cable connections to insure that they are free

of moisture and contamination.

STEP 3 Inspect and replace damaged component boards and

cable assemblies.

4.7 ALTERNATIVE VALVING CONFIGURATIONS AND

OPERATION FOR CONTINUOUS PROCESS WATER

NOTE:

The following methods will provide an uninterrupted water supply

to process if a fresh Dl bank is NOT in place when the other Dl

bank exhausts. Refer to Fig. 2 - and 2-5 on page 5.
OPTION 1 Requirements:

Continuous process. No interruptions allowed.

Connections:

“A” output (TB2-5) to “A” valve AND “B” valve.

“B” output not connected.

Bleed not connected.

Omit bleed valve.

Configure “A” valve Normally Closed & “B” valve

Normally Open.

OPTION 2 Requirements:

Continuous process. Holding tank between Dl beds

and process.

Purge ok but no prolonged shutdown.

Connections:

Bleed output (TB2-4) connected to bleed valve.

Bleed configured as Normally Closed.

Other connections same as Option 1.

OPTION 3 Requirements:

Continuous process. Purge required only at system

startup.

Connections:

Same as Option 2.

Add manual valve in line with Bleed Valve.
